Many international students in Canada are currently limited to working up to 24 hours per week. However, there is a legal way to work full-time as a student — through co-op programs and internships.
In this video, I explain how international students can work full-time in Canada using a co-op work permit, how co-op placements work, and why this option can allow you to work full-time for multiple academic terms depending on your program and school.
If you’re an international student looking for ways to gain Canadian work experience and earn more while studying, this video is for you.

On this page, you will find general information and useful resources to guide you through the options that are available to foreign candidates. If you want to come to Canada but have not yet applied for an immigration program or a work permit, **visit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C) to get started.**. If you have already started the process to immigrate to Canada or to get a work permit, you can search for jobs from employers who are recruiting foreign candidates. * 3 Search and apply to jobs. If you want to immigrate to Canada, start by learning about the different programs you can apply for. Before applying to jobs in Canada, you need to find out if you are eligible to get a work permit. When starting the process to immigrate to Canada or get a work permit, you should only apply to jobs from employers who are recruiting international candidates.
